RingO lets tablet owners mount their devices onto any surface

Image ipad-mounted-wall.jpg

European company Vogel’s launched a new patented RingO universal tablet mounting system for tablets, including the original iPad, iPad 2 and Samsung Galaxy Tab, with new versions for additional devices available at a later date. Using RingO, users are able to mount their tablet onto virtually any surface such as wall, car, tile and boat – to watch movies, read the latest news or use any app. Thanks to RingO’s modular design, you can quickly snap the RingO Cover onto a tablet, which then can be clicked securely onto a variety of RingO mounts . . . → Read More: RingO lets tablet owners mount their devices onto any surface

Upcoming OtterBox Case for Motorola Xoom is Dock-Friendly

Image OtterBox-Xoom-6-660x440.jpg

At CTIA, OtterBox was showing off their work-in-progress case for the Motorola Xoom tablet. As usual, it’ll have the three layers of protection (silicon skin, hard plastic frame, and splash-resistant screen protector), and the extra outer hard case can act as a stand just like OtterBox’s other tablet products, but the one really interesting addition to the Xoom case are two flaps, with one built into the other. If you just need access to the plugs at the bottom, you can open the smaller one, but if you need to dock the Xoom (for HDMI or whatever else), you can open up a larger flap so everything can click into place . . . → Read More: Upcoming OtterBox Case for Motorola Xoom is Dock-Friendly
